WebJul 4, 2014 · Classical approach of management professes the body of management thought based on the belief that employees have only economical and physical needs and that the social needs & needs for job satisfaction either does not exist or are unimportant. Developed by Frederick Taylor, the classical theory of management advocated a scientific study of tasks and the workers responsible for them.
